Key Advantages of Copovidone VA64

Exceptional Binding Properties

Copovidone VA64 serves as a highly effective dry binder, providing excellent adhesion and tablet hardness. It is ideal for direct compression and wet granulation, ensuring process efficiency for manufacturers.

Improved Film-Forming Capabilities

This versatile polymer acts as a superior film-former, crucial for tablet coating and cosmetic hair-fixation applications. Its properties improve uniformity and enhance product appeal.

Reduced Hygroscopicity and Enhanced Plasticity

Compared to traditional povidone, Copovidone VA64 exhibits lower hygroscopicity and greater plasticity, making it more reliable in varying humidity conditions and for formulations prone to capping. This makes it a preferred choice when you want to buy excipients with superior handling.

Diverse Applications for Copovidone VA64

Pharmaceutical Formulations

As a key pharmaceutical intermediate, Copovidone VA64 is widely used as a binder in tablet manufacturing, aiding both direct compression and wet granulation processes. Its role in creating solid dispersions is vital for improving the bioavailability of poorly soluble drugs.

Controlled-Release Systems

Copovidone VA64 is instrumental in developing matrix materials for controlled-release formulations, ensuring predictable drug delivery and enhanced therapeutic outcomes for patients.

Cosmetic Industry

In cosmetics, Copovidone VA64 functions as an excellent film-former and hair-fixing agent. Its ability to reduce hygroscopicity makes it ideal for hair sprays and styling lotions, offering reliable hold and texture.

Adhesives and Dispersions

Beyond pharmaceuticals and cosmetics, Copovidone VA64 finds utility as a remoistenable adhesive and a viscosity-enhancing agent in printing inks. It also acts as a protecting colloid in plant protection chemicals and as a binder in coatings.
